Overview of Trademark Class 21

Trademark Class 21 includes Household or kitchen utensils, containers; combs, sponges; brushes ; small hand-operated utensils and apparatus for household and kitchen use, as well as toilet apparatus glassware and certain goods made of porcelain, ceramic, earthenware or glass.

Concept of Trademark Classification

The NICE Classification was recognized in 1957 by NICE Agreement and it distinguishes trademarks into 45 different classes of Goods and Services, Classes 1-34 for Goods and Classes 35-45 for Services. The purpose of this categorization is to allow users to seek registration of trademark of goods or services into classes that are more suitable with the type of business applicant have. List of Trademark Class 21 does NOT include the following items:-

  • Class 7 - Power-driven small household apparatuses for mean activities;
  • Class 3 - Cleaning preparations, soaps;
  • Class 11 - Electric cooking apparatuses and utensils;
  • Class 20 - Toilet mirrors
  • Class 8 - Equipment for shaving, manicure, pedicure, etc.
  • Class 17 - Glass wool for insulation
  • Class 5 - Certain goods made of glass, porcelain and earthenware that are classified according to their function or purpose, for example, porcelain for dental prostheses
  • Class 9 - Spectacle lenses
  • Class 19 - Earthenware tiles
